欧洲硬木木材的未来可用性是林业界的关注焦点。报告指出,欧洲硬木库存,如橡树、山毛榉和桦木,约占总库存的29%,大约为8180万立方米。在中部和南部欧洲,硬木和软木的份额大约各占一半,但在南部地区的库存显著较低。由于气候变化,硬木生长速度加快,物种分布发生变化,例如挪威云杉。气候变化导致硬木木材产量增加,生长周期缩短,大径材的比例提高,但高质量木材的成本增加,需要更多的林业知识和技术。硬木木材主要用于生物质生产和能源用途,对减缓气候变化有重要作用。面对全球害虫和气候变化的威胁,林业通过选择和繁殖抗病克隆树种,实施了一系列旨在恢复和保护硬木林的举措。这些举措包括在共同花园中种植超过35,000棵苗木,以及建立含有精英克隆材料的种子园。尽管存在挑战,但文章强调了通过科技进步和改变经营方式,硬木林业有望为气候缓解作出更大贡献。
